Mon Oct 17, 2022 · 18:00

City Council

Council discusses creating a new $500,000 Economic Development Fund

The City Council will discuss establishing a new fund for economic development projects using a $500,000 transfer from the American Rescue Plan Act fund. The agenda also includes ratifying recent city warrants and adopting updated building and fire codes.

economic-developmentpolicebudgetbuilding-codespublic-safety
✓ Decided: Council creates $500K economic development fund, adopts building codes

The City Council voted unanimously to create a new Economic Development Fund (Fund 57) with an initial $500,000 transfer from the American Rescue Plan Act fund. The council also unanimously approved first reading of ordinances adopting the 2022 California Building Standards Code and Fire Code, with second reading set for November 14, 2022. All consent calendar items were approved, including ratification of $1,673,441.04 in warrants, acceptance of a street sign replacement project, and purchase of a police pursuit vehicle for $54,469.11. Council Member Jordan Nefulda was appointed as the alternate representative to the Orange County Sanitation District Board.

Wed Sep 28, 2022 · 19:00

Planning Commission

Planning Commission to consider permit for secondhand store at 10582 Los Alamitos Blvd

The Planning Commission will hold public hearings regarding a driveway variance at 4321 Howard Avenue and a conditional use permit for a secondhand store. The commission will also discuss the future use of Community Development Block Grant funds.

zoningbusinesshousingcommunity-developmentpublic-hearing
✓ Decided: Planning Commission denies driveway variance for Howard Avenue project

The Planning Commission denied a variance (VAR 22-01) that would have allowed a public-street-side driveway to remain after construction of a residential addition at 4321 Howard Avenue, where alley access is required. The vote was 4-0 with one abstention. The commission also failed to approve a conditional use permit for a secondhand store at 10582 Los Alamitos Boulevard (2-2, one abstention) and instead continued the item to October 26, 2022, for the business to come into compliance with codes.

Mon Aug 15, 2022 · 17:30

City Council

Council to consider updates to the City’s 2021-2029 Housing Element

The Council will hold a public hearing regarding the update of the City's Housing Element for 2021-2029. Members will also discuss Phase II of the Economic Development Plan and the potential use of American Rescue Plan Act funds. Additionally, the Council is scheduled to review various service contract amendments and city warrants.

housingpoliceeconomic-developmentbudgetparkscontracts
✓ Decided: Council adopts military equipment policy and housing element update

The City Council adopted Ordinance No. 2022-04, the AB 481 Military Equipment Use Policy, and Resolution No. 2022-20 approving the 2021-2029 Housing Element update with a Negative Declaration. They also ratified warrants totaling $1,832,256.43, approved consent calendar items including contract amendments, rejected bids for the Sterns Park Improvement Project, and authorized use of ARPA funds for economic development programs.

Wed Apr 27, 2022 · 19:00

Planning Commission

Planning Commission to consider updates to the City’s Housing Element

The Planning Commission will discuss residential density requirements across various city zones. The meeting also includes public hearings for a housing element update and two business permit applications.

housingzoningbusinesspublic-hearing
✓ Decided: Planning Commission recommends Housing Element update, approves two CUPs

The Planning Commission voted 4-0 to recommend the City Council adopt a Negative Declaration and approve General Plan Amendment 21-01, updating the Housing Element for 2021-2029. It also approved two conditional use permits: an expansion of Cinema Escape Room at 4298 Katella Avenue and a new massage establishment at 11110 Los Alamitos Blvd #106. The commission approved the February 23, 2022 minutes and made findings to continue teleconferencing under AB 361.

Wed Feb 23, 2022 · 19:00

Planning Commission

Review of the Los Alamitos Town Center Mixed Use Strategic Plan draft

The Planning Commission is reviewing a draft strategic plan for the Town Center Mixed Use (TCMU) zone. Funded by an SB2 grant, the plan aims to revitalize the area near Katella and Los Alamitos Boulevards through mixed-use development. It includes proposals for streetscape improvements on Pine Street and new housing options.

zoninghousingurban-designplanningtown-centerstreetscape
✓ Decided: Planning Commission recommends TCMU Strategic Plan and approves chicken ordinance

The Planning Commission voted 6-0 to recommend the Town Center Mixed Use (TCMU) Zone Strategic Plan to the City Council, including its EIR addendum. They also approved a zoning ordinance amendment (ZOA 21-01) to permit keeping live fowl (chickens) with specific requirements, such as a maximum of four chickens and a coop 20 feet from dwellings. The commission also made findings to continue teleconferencing meetings due to COVID-19.

Tue Jan 25, 2022 · 18:00

Budget Standing Committee

Los Alamitos Budget Committee reviews financial updates and pension liabilities

The Budget Standing Committee is reviewing the city's financial status for Fiscal Year 2020-21 and projections for Fiscal Year 2021-22. The committee will also discuss funding policies for the PERS Unfunded Actuarial Liability and a proposed Finance Department reorganization.

budgetfinancepensionlos-alamitosfiscal-year
✓ Decided: Committee forwards Finance Dept reorganization to Council

The Budget Standing Committee approved forwarding recommended Finance Department personnel changes to the City Council for approval. The committee also reviewed the FY 2020-21 financial update, discussed the PERS unfunded actuarial liability and Section 115 Trust, and previewed the Govinvest pension liability model. Staff was asked to study additional funding scenarios for early pension paydown, including a 15-year option.
